I took an airplane to Amsterdam in, Paris out in the Netherlands. I wanted to go to the surrounding countries because it was a big deal, so I bought a Benelux Pass for 4 days this time. The route I actually used is like this. ① Skippol Airport → Den Hague → Delft → Rotterdam → Amsterdam ② Amsterdam → Bruges ③ Bruges → Luxembourg → Brussels ④ Brussels → Antoine P → Brussels It's 4 days, but it's okay if you don't have to be 4 consecutive days, so if you're going to Holland, Belgium and Luxembourg, please do! Recommended 🇳🇱🇧🇪🇱🇺 When the conductor comes, it feels like showing the QR code and holding the QR code at the ticket gate. It's easy to use. When using it, it's good to take an app called Rail Planner.
